We had to post our 4 1/2 week grades this week. Thankfully my wife told me what needed to be done because my administration did not. First of all I finally realized I needed to be keeping a gradebook this past week - just kidding!!!!!!! Actually, my wife told me to keep a hard copy of all grades in the gradebook we had to purchase from the school box. The school system no longer purchases gradebooks for the teachers because we are required to keep our grades in the computer. My school system keeps grades in "Portal". We also keep attendance in this system as well. Guess when I received formal training from my school on this system? Yes, you guessed it 2 weeks after school started. Portal lost my grades once and then lost my "intern" grades. If I had not kept a hard copy of my grades, I would really be upset at this point. My students grades are visible in the system, however, even my department head has no idea if my grades will actually show up on the progress reports that my students receive tomorrow (Friday). We only assume that they will because the academic administrator has not sent me any nasty emails stating for me to enter my grades. I was suppose to print my grade verifications however I cannot print in my room because technology has still not arrived to install my printers (I have sent in 4 work requests).
Dr. Burns wasn't kidding when she stated that pre-planning had really nothing to do with planning. They should have taken the teachers new to the system and given us instruction on Portal amongst other things rather than making us attend meetings that were not applicable to first year teachers.
